Abstract

The utility model discloses a push rod die for a heat shrink film machine. The push rod die comprises a baffle and a carriage, and is characterized in that the baffle is separated into a horizontal baffle and a vertical baffle, the horizontal baffle is of a linear structure, and the lower side of the vertical baffle is bent leftward; the carriage with an m-shaped structure is arranged at the lower side of the horizontal baffle; and a first arc hole and a second arc hole are respectively formed in left and right sides of the carriage. The push rod die has the characteristic of reasonable structure design, and is convenient to use.
